                    HP 166, Resolve, To Provide Rural Nonmedical Transportation Services To The Elderly And Adults With Disabilities Receiving Home And Community Benefits Under Mainecare
                
                
            
        Last Action See all actions
                         Senate • Apr 29, 2025: Pursuant to Joint Rule 310.3 Placed in Legislative Files (DEAD)

       Actions
            - Apr 29, 2025 | Senate- Pursuant to Joint Rule 310.3 Placed in Legislative Files (DEAD)
 
- Apr 23, 2025 | legislature- Reported Out - ONTP
 
- Apr 15, 2025 | legislature- Work Session (Cross Building, Room 209)
- Work Session Held
- Voted - ONTP
 
- Apr 03, 2025 | legislature- Public Hearing (Cross Building, Room 209)
 
- Mar 21, 2025 | House- Carried over, in the same posture, to the next special or regular session of the 132nd Legislature, pursuant to Joint Order SP 519.
 
- Jan 23, 2025 | House- Received by the Clerk of the House on January 23, 2025.
- The Resolve was REFERRED to the Committee on H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ES pursuant to Joint Rule 308.2 and ordered printed pursuant to Joint Rule 401.
